ensp中ospf的配置
时间: 2023-10-18 16:04:30 浏览: 128
在ENSP(Enterprise Network Simulation Platform)中配置OSPF(Open Shortest Path First)协议时,需要进行以下步骤:
1. 创建网络拓扑:使用ENSP创建网络拓扑,包括路由器和连接它们的链路。
2. 配置IP地址:为每个接口配置IP地址,并确保接口之间的互联。
3. 启用OSPF进程:在每个路由器上启用OSPF进程,并指定进程ID。例如,使用以下命令在路由器R1上启用OSPF进程:
```
[R1] ospf 1
```
4. 配置区域:将每个接口分配到一个OSPF区域。例如,使用以下命令将接口GigabitEthernet 0/0/1分配到区域0:
```
[R1-GigabitEthernet0/0/1] ospf network-type p2p
***
相关问题
ensp中ospf配置
### 如何在ENSP中配置OSPF协议
#### 一、配置OSPF进程
为了使路由器能够参与OSPF路由过程,在每台路由器上启动OSPF进程至关重要。这通常涉及指定唯一的进程号,该编号在同一台设备内唯一即可。
```shell
[Huawei] ospf [process-id]
```
此命令用于开启OSPF功能,并创建一个新的OSPF实例[^2]。
#### 二、定义网络区域划分
接着需指明哪些接口加入特定的OSPF区域内,这是通过network命令完成的。它允许管理员声明哪一部分IP地址空间属于哪个OSPF区域。
```shell
[Huawei-ospf-[process-id]] area [area-id]
[Huawei-ospf-[process-id]-area-[area-id]] network [ip-address] [wildcard-mask]
```
上述指令将具体网段关联至给定的OSPF区域下。
#### 三、设定Router ID
每一台运行OSPF的路由器都需要有一个独一无二的身份标识——即Router ID。可以通过手动方式来设置这个参数:
```shell
[Huawei] router id [router-id]
```
这里`[router-id]`通常是IPv4格式表示的一个数值字符串。
#### 四、建立邻居关系
当两台直连路由器之间建立了邻接关系之后,它们就可以交换链路状态信息了。确保物理连接正常工作并且双方都正确设置了相同的认证机制(如果有),这样才能顺利建立起稳定的邻居关系[^1]。
#### 五、验证配置效果
一旦完成了以上所有步骤,则应该利用一些诊断工具来进行测试,比如使用`display ospf peer`查看当前存在的邻居列表;或者借助于`ping`命令检验不同子网间的可达性。如果发现无法通信的现象,建议返回检查OSPF的相关配置是否存在错误。
```shell
[Huawei] display ospf peer
[Huawei] ping [-a source-ip] destination-ip
```
#### 六、观察OSPF路由表项
最终还可以查阅OSPF生成的路由条目,确认是否已经学到了预期之外部或内部路径。
```shell
[Huawei] display ospf routing
```
这样就能够在ENSP平台上实现基本的OSPF协议部署与调试操作了。
ENSP中ospf配置代码
### ENSP 中 OSPF 配置示例代码与指南
在华为的企业网络仿真平台(eNSP)中,可以通过模拟路由器来完成 OSPF 的配置。以下是基于引用内容以及标准实践总结的 OSPF 配置流程和示例代码。
#### 1. 启动 OSPF 进程
在路由器上启用 OSPF 并指定一个唯一的进程 ID。此操作通常通过 `router ospf` 命令实现。
```shell
Router(config)# router ospf 1
```
#### 2. 定义区域并宣告网络
将特定的子网加入到 OSPF 路由进程中,并将其分配至某个区域(通常是 Area 0)。这一步骤确保了网络被正确划分到对应的区域内。
```shell
Router(config-router)# network 192.168.1.0 0.0.0.255 area 0
```
以上命令表明,IP 地址范围为 `192.168.1.0/24` 的子网已被宣告进入 OSPF 区域 0[^1]。
#### 3. 查看邻居状态
为了验证 OSPF 邻居关系是否已成功建立,可执行以下命令以检查邻居的状态:
```shell
Router# display ospf peer
```
当邻居状态显示为 **Full** 时,说明两台设备间的 OSPF 关系已经完全建立[^2]。
#### 4. 故障排查技巧
如果遇到邻居关系未能正常建立的情况,需重点核查以下几个方面:
- 确认所有涉及设备的区域 ID 是否一致;
- 检查网络类型是否存在冲突,尤其是 DR/BDR 选举过程中可能产生的异常;
- 如果启用了认证功能,则应保证各端口使用的认证密钥相同[^2]。
#### 5. 批量配置下发 (可选)
对于大规模部署场景,可以借助自动化工具如 Ansible 来简化重复性的配置工作。下面展示了一段使用 Ansible 对多台交换机进行 VLAN 和基础路由配置的例子:
```yaml
---
- name: 批量配置OSPF及VLAN
hosts: routers
gather_facts: no
tasks:
- name: 创建管理VLAN
ensp_vlan:
vlan_id: 100
name: Management
- name: 配置OSPF基本参数
ensp_config:
lines:
- "router ospf 1"
- "network 192.168.1.0 0.0.0.255 area 0"
```
上述 YAML 文件定义了一个 Playbook,用于向目标主机群组推送必要的初始设置,其中包括创建名为 *Management* 的 VLAN 以及初始化 OSPF 设置[^3]。
---
###
阅读全文
相关推荐













